That Spot in Every Ocean

I had seen her beauty a couple places
mornings  rising,  evenings as it rests
that spot in every ocean
where the sun always looks its best. 

Her beauty seemed radiant
it brightened my darkest room
now it lives only in my memories
she left me far too soon.

I placed an urn on the mantle
the room seemed to fade to black
I wept into my only thought
you are never coming back.

I took her off the mantle
then just before the day was done
I let her drift with a westward wind
now she tags along with the sun.

She's found now a couple places
mornings rising, evenings as it rests
that spot in every ocean
she was always meant to look her best.
